Output dd1121169932535e4ae6af9a2621514d39079b258519f29753e2d31206c9cf85:0

value
999958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688e6682386a9a012e77c179d4eb8d388adf6655 OP_EQUAL
address
3BDrnebifWwBCsFarUnpxhjcc5pM7SDLty
transaction
dd1121169932535e4ae6af9a2621514d39079b258519f29753e2d31206c9cf85
spent
true